Individual-differences assessment of the relationship between change in and initial level of adult cognitive functioning.

Abstract

Methodological factors may have been partially responsible for the inconsistency in findings from previous investigations into the relationship between change in, and initial level of, adult cognitive functioning. An alternative data-analytic procedure is proposed and applied to data from 277 men (25-76 years of age at initial testing) over 3 measurement occasions (interwave intervals of 6.7 years). Performances on both the Benton Revised Visual Retention Test (BVRT) and the Wechsler Adult Intelligence Scale (WAIS) Vocabulary subtest were analyzed. The findings demonstrate that the significant negative relationships between change and initial status, found on both tests, were partially a function of measurement error. Once adjustments were made for errors of measurement, the previously significant negative relationship for the BVRT data became significantly positive, whereas for the WAIS the relationship remained significantly negative, although to a lesser degree. The importance of accounting for errors of measurement is discussed.
